Last month was the world's hottest November on record 'by a clear margin' as Europe basked in its highest autumn temperatures in history, the EU's satellite monitoring service said today.
Global temperatures were 0.8C warmer than the typical November from 1981-2010, and in Europe they were 2.2C hotter, according to the Copernicus Climate Change service (C3S).
